Product Description

The Nyack Scarf from Wallace Sewell adds a vibrant touch to any outfit with its rich colors inspired by American artists Lois Dodd and Edward Hopper. Crafted from 100% lambswool, this accessory offers warmth and style, featuring a striking design that reflects suburban architecture and landscapes. Measuring 69 inches long and 8 inches wide, it is perfect for draping or wrapping. At once artistic and functional, this scarf is an essential addition to any wardrobe. From the brand: This warm Nyack Scarf from UK-based brand Wallace Sewell is made from 100% lambswool and is inspired by the works of American artists Lois Dodd and Edward Hopper. “We first found the work of Lois Dodd and fell in love with her use of color and light, depicting a mix of suburban architecture, windows, landscapes and floral garden scenes in and around her homes along the east coast,” say Wallace Sewell founders Harriet Wallace-Jones and Emma Sewell. “We felt that her work had echoes of Edward Hopper's paintings and decided the pair would make a great source of inspiration.” The Wallace Sewell Lambswool Nyak Scarf measures 69l x 8”w.
